Переход бизнеса в онлайн — неизбежность. Но вместе с увеличением продаж товаров и услуг, появляются и риски, связанные с управлением репутацией. Если сайт более 10 минут не доступен, то страдает не только репутация компании. Поисковики могут понизить позиции, снова придется вкладывать деньги в развитие и продвижение. А в случае с хакерскими атаками — еще и на восстановление сайта.
Второй риск — DDoS атаки. DDoS атаки организовывают хакеры по собственной инициативе или по заказу конкурентов. Мощная атака приводит к падению серверов. В это время вы не получаете доступ к хранилищу данных, а клиенты не получают доступ к сайту.
Что делать? Не выходить в онлайн? Нет, это не выход, ибо как говорил Билл Гейтс: «Если вас нет в интернете, значит, вы не существуете».
Есть несколько вариантов: стандартный классический хостинг, виртуальный хостинг, выделенный сервер. Этими хостингами пользуются все, они доступны. Однако, доступны не только вам, но и хакерским группам.
В случае падения хостинга при DDoS атаках, восстановление происходит медленно, а время — ваши деньги. Серверная часть администрируется вручную, что не исключается человеческий фактор и ошибки.
Но что самое главное — ваш проект хранится на одном, выделенном пространстве, а значит, имеет точку отказа.
Мы рекомендуем базировать свои данные на наших серверах, построенных на архитектуре Ceph. Заказать надежное хранилище ваших данных (сайт, данные, сервис), можно в этой форме.
Если хотите узнать подробнее о технологии — читайте далее.
Файловая система хранения данных, имеет блочную систему. Она полностью настраиваемая и легко администрируемая. Файловая система совместима с различными языками программирования, обеспечивает максимально быстрый доступ к хранимым объектам.
Файловая система Ceph обеспечивает максимальную производительность. Сегодня потеря времени равнозначна потере бизнеса, а от скорости загрузки сайта зависит ваш имидж и ваш бизнес.
Ceph — технология безотказного хостинга, благодаря которой ваш сайт будет доступен всегда. Вы не потеряете данные, даже если произойдут сбои в случаях чрезвычайных ситуаций.
Если один из дисков выходит из строя, то данные не теряются, а сайт работать не перестает. Все данные вашего проекта имеют копии, сохраненные на сервере. Действия с серверами прозрачны, их легко мониторить.
Это зависит от переменной, которая меняется на лету: size. В зависимости от того, какое ей присвоить значение, столько копий и осядет на серверах. Например, size=3 — три копии проекта, size=4 — четыре копии проекта и так далее. Причем само ПО перераспределяет и копирует данные, для этого не нужно вмешательство человека. Это исключает человеческий фактор и связанные с ним ошибки.
Система хранит все данные в пулах — контейнере, который может храниться как на одном диске, так и на нескольких. Для каждого из контейнеров (пулов) настраивается своя точка отказа и репликация (размер), а также место хранения, датацентр, диск и т.д.
Карты путей больше не хранятся на серверах, что снижает нагрузку при поиске. Благодаря алгоритму CRUSH нагрузка на сервера снижается. Запрос пути к объекту происходит через монитор, и каждый клиент запрашивает его самостоятельно. Кроме того, изначально карта плоская, но если вы хотите распределить информацию по различным серверам, вы легко это сможете сделать и превратить плоскость в дерево.
В данном методе предполагается, что сначала информация записывается на OSD, потом кластеризуется, а на самом диске остаются только журналы. Метод прост, надежен, но не масштабируется. При необходимости внести быстрые изменения, лучше использовать кэш-тиринг.
В данном методе предполагается, что сначала информация записывается на OSD, потом кластеризуется, а на самом диске остаются только журналы. Метод прост, надежен, но не масштабируется. При необходимости внести быстрые изменения, лучше использовать кэш-тиринг.
Кэш-тиринг — гибкий, легко масштабируется. При частых обращениях и высокой нагрузке клиент попадает в горячий пул SSD диска. Как только нагрузка снижается, объект перемещается в холодную зону HDD. В кэш-тиринге можно заменить SSD быстро, а все температурные и временные параметры регулируются.
Если вы не программист и не планируете устанавливать свое ПО, заниматься пулами, отслеживать мониторы и так далее — вы просто получаете: сервер, разграничение прав доступа, шлюз и возможность проводить вычисления.
Использование Ceph позволяет не думать о железе и серверах — Ceph все распределяет сам, проверяет ответы сервера, регулирует распределение и работу проектов. Вы можете использовать Ceph в качестве хранилища данных.
Если у вас остались вопросы или сомнения, мы расскажем вам о преимуществах и недостатках каждой из систем хранения данных (хостинге) простым языком. Получите серверы с высокой отказоустойчивостью уже сейчас, не заставляя клиентов искать вас в интернете.
Разработка качественного продукта нуждается в
команде профессионалов.
Обсудить проект